

Robert Louis Sulligan age 85, of Nashville, TN passed away on Sunday, April 30, 2023 in Murfreesboro, Tennessee. Bob was born to the late Peter George Sr. Sulligan and Anna (Dulovits) Sulligan on March 29, 1938 in New Brunswick, New Jersey.
Bob was served in the United State Air Force for 24 years where he retired as a Master Sargent, he served in Vietnam, Korea, Japan and various Air Force bases around the world. Bob and Loretta (Janey) spent time in Texas, then relocated to Nashville, Tennessee. Bob started working the Gaylord Opryland in Nashville, Tennessee, where he worked 18 years. In those 18 years he served as their 1st Ambassador, coached softball, and was known to many as “MIDNIGHT BOB.” He was a member of the Knights of Columbus, a past member of the Adult Choir at St. Edwards and Holy Rosary, a member and advisor of the Saddle Tramps – Texas Tech University. He was a member of the Fifty and Nifty group. He also played Semi-pro baseball for the St. Louis Cardinals in the early 1960’s.
Bob never met a stranger; he was loved by many and he loved with his whole heart. He cherished his wife of 63, his children and had a blast with his grand and great-grandchildren. There was never a dull moment with him around.
